Docente

Páginas: 5 (1163 palabras) Publicado: 23 de junio de 2013


Trabajo practico N°1 – Programación II
1. Qué tipo de datos resulta más adecuado para representar cada uno de los conceptos siguientes:
a) El sueldo de un trabajador = float
b) La edad de una persona = String
c) El número de hijos = int
d) El estado civil = String
e) El estado de caducado de un producto = String
f) El n° de teléfono = long
g) La dirección = String + int
2.Escribir un programa que pida una cantidad en pesos y la convierta en euros.
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ace PesosaEuros
{class Program
{static void Main(string[] args){
int peso;
float resultado;
float euros = 6.77f;
Console.WriteLine("Ingrese la cantidad de pesos:");peso = int.Parse(Console.ReadLine());
resultado = peso / euros;
Console.WriteLine("Usted tiene " + resultado.ToString("0.00"));
Console.ReadKey(); }}}

3. A partir del programa anterior escribir uno que pase de pesos a Dólar, pidiendo primero cuantos pesos es un Dólar.
using System;
using System.Collections.Generic;
using System.Linq;
usingSystem.Text;
namespace PesosaEuros
{class Program
{static void Main(string[] args){
float peso;
float resultado;
float dolar;
Console.WriteLine("Ingrese la cantidad de pesos:");
peso = float.Parse(Console.ReadLine());
Console.WriteLine("Ingrese el valor del dolar");
dolar = float.Parse(Console.ReadLine());resultado = peso / dolar;
Console.WriteLine("Usted tiene " + resultado.ToString("0.00"));
Console.ReadKey();}}}

4. Escribir un programa para calcular el importe de una venta en un supermercado. El usuario debe indicar el nombre del producto, el precio por unidad y el n° de unidades y el programa sacará por pantalla el nombre del producto, el n° deunidades vendidas y el precio total. Preste especial atención a qué tipo de datos resulta más adecuado para cada representar cada cantidad.
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ace PesosaEuros
{class Program
{static void Main(string[] args){
string nombre;
int numero;
float precio;float total;
Console.WriteLine("Ingrese el nombre del producto ");
nombre = Convert.ToString(Console.ReadLine());
Console.WriteLine("Cual es el precio del producto por unidad ");
precio = float.Parse(Console.ReadLine());
Console.WriteLine("Ingrese el numero de unidades ");
numero = int.Parse(Console.ReadLine());total = numero * precio;
Console.WriteLine("Se vendieron " + numero + " del producto " + nombre + " a un precio de " + total);
Console.ReadKey();}}}

5. Escribir un programa que calcule la nómina de un trabajador de la manera siguiente. El trabajador cobra un precio fijo por hora y se le retiene un 5% en concepto de IRPF. El programa debe pedir el nombre deltrabajador, las horas trabajadas y el precio que cobra por hora. Como salida debe imprimir el sueldo bruto, la retención y el sueldo neto.
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ace PesosaEuros
{class Program
{static void Main(string[] args){
string Nombre;
float Horas;
string linea;
floatSueldoxhora;
string Sueldoxhora1;
float Sueldobruto;
float descuento;
float sueldoneto;
Console.Write("Ingrese el nombre del empleado ");
Nombre = Console.ReadLine();
Console.Write("Cuantas horas trabajo " + Nombre + " ");
linea = Console.ReadLine();
Horas = float.Parse(linea);...
Leer documento completo

Regístrate para leer el documento completo.

Estos documentos también te pueden resultar útiles

  • Docente
  • Docente
  • Estado docente
  • Docente
  • Docente
  • Docente
  • Docente
  • Docente

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S